The five most glaring issues are:

1) Neck is too long. One of the reasons I went with a Barney over T-800. Barney's neck is more realistically shorter and heads sit better on it.

2) Small hands. The blade gloves, in comparison with the arms, look really tiny. Almost like he has women's hands. Maybe find some bigger gloves that give him a nice set of sledgehammers.

3) The pants. I'd try and find some elastic pants to replace them as the slacks just look weird with the rest of the outfit.

4) The shirt. I'd add a hem to the neck cut on the T-shirt. Not only will it look more finished, but without it, over time the shirt's only gonna unweave. As for the USA, it looks sharp!

5) The whistle choker. The string needs to be long enough to where he can lift it to his mouth and blow the whistle. I'd drop it down to at least mid-pectoral like the OG figure if not all the way down to the solar plexus.
